=====Vantage Film Hawk V-Lite Vintage '74 80mm T2.3 ===== (INSERT SINGLE HERO IMAGE HERE - other images below in media section) ==== Summary ==== Combining two established looks – 1.3x squeeze and 1970s vintage feel. The versatile Hawk V‑Lite 1.3x lenses either use the full 16:9 sensor area for wide-screen release or the entire 4:3 sensor for 16:9 television.
